Description 

This wall stays shaded. It holds about six routes. The ultra classic Riders of the Storm was the first route to done at Parks.


Getting There 

Pass the maple wall, go around the mushroom boulder over small rocks/boulders. This wall will to your left and the huge slab wall you will be facing is Main face.

Featured Route For Mushroom Wall

Riders Of the Storm 5.8  ME : Clifton Crags : ... : Mushroom Wall
Start by pulling on the huge flake in the diheral leading a bolt. The first moves can be protected by a big cam. Clip that bolt or proceed left to second bolt. The first bolt is not part of this route. If you clip it then unclip it after clipping second bolt to avoid rope drag. After second bolt, proceed straight up.
